First Fate/stay night Heaven’s Feel will be a film trilogy, which will kick off in 2017. The project was first announced along with the Fate/stay night: Unlimited Blade Works TV series, though it was originally slated to be a single film at the time.
First Fate/stay night Heaven’s Feel will adapt the “Heaven’s Feel” branch of the Fate/stay night visual novel. Tomonori Sudou (Fate/stay night: Unlimited Blade Works) will helm the project at ufotable, with Takahiro Miura providing storyboards. Yuki Kajiura (Puella Magi Madoka Magica, Madlax) will score the films’ soundtracks.
The confirmed voice cast includes:
- Sakura Matō: Noriko Shitaya
- Kirei Kotomine: Jouji Nakata
- Rin Tohsaka: Kana Ueda
- Illyasviel von Einzbern: Mai Kadowaki
- Shirō Emiya: Noriaki Sugiyama
- Rider: Yuu Asakawa
